>>378357279
XBone has Battletoads, PS4 has Kratos. All the Nintendo exclusive stuff either requires an Amiibo or has been patched into other versions; the biggest thing Nintendo had was a timed exclusive for Spectre of Torment, getting it a month early on the Switch (not even the Wii U version got it until everyone else did). PC doesn't really have anything exclusive.

>>378359830
Apparently the game is selling as well as it ever had, and never really dropped off, so I doubt it. On the other hand they apparently put a LOT more money into the expansions than the Kickstarter paid for (Spectre of Torment may as well be a completely original game made with the same engine, because the levels, boss fights, and most of the OST was completely redone from scratch for it), so maybe that cut too deep into it.

I honestly can't even tell if this is bait or not at this point since I've encountered countless idiots here, but I'll just voice my opinion on how much I like it.

It's definitely worth the money imo, charming graphics and extremely memorable characters and fun music that will have you humming tunes for days. To the first person I quoted, the game actually plays very well since you always feel in control of your character. It has amazing design in the first level that serves as its own tutorial like super metroid: you find yourself in a situation that seems tricky, so you yourself try new things to overcome obstacles instead of being handheld into being directly told to do a certain action. It also promotes exploration for secrets since you can get some nice rewards for doing so. They take away the whole system of lives and replace it with losing the treasure you've found in the level, and if you're feeling confident you can destroy checkpoints for even more loot. Overall an amazing game that has tons of replay value.

One of the very few complaints I have however is how frustrating it can be to make a jump over a gap to a platform but get thrown off into a pit as soon as you touch the enemy on said platform.
